SCO has released PC Card (The Standard Formerly Known As PCMCIA) drivers for OpenServer Release 5 as TLS619.
Lynnsoft (sales@lynnsoft.com, https://www.lynnsoft.com/software.htm) also makes PC Card drivers for SCO Unix.
